Congenital diaphragmatic hernia: US diagnosis prior to 22 weeks gestation.

Abstract
Two cases of congenital diaphragmatic hernia diagnosed sonographically in utero at 18 and 21 weeks gestation are described. In previous reports, this diagnosis has been made at 28 weeks or more. Recognition of this severe abnormality in the second trimester affords two options. The parents can interrupt the pregnancy, or a surgical attempt at correction in utero may be possible and be early enough to allow adequate lung development to take place.
